Example
2x in percentage is 100%
3x in percentage is 200%
4x in percentage is 300%
5x in percentage is 400%
6x in percentage is 500%
7x in percentage is 600%
8x in percentage is 700%
9x in percentage is 800%
10x in percentage is 900%
20x in percentage is 1900%
30x in percentage is 2900%
40x in percentage is 3900%
50x in percentage is 4900%
60x in percentage is 5900%
70x in percentage is 6900%
80x in percentage is 7900%
90x in percentage is 8900%
100x in percentage is 9900%
200x in percentage is 19900%
300x in percentage is 29900%
400x in percentage is 39900%
500x in percentage is 49900%
